Method for establishment of service discovery tool based on service network

A service discovery and service network technology, applied in special data processing applications, instruments, electrical digital data processing, etc., can solve problems such as inability to apply, and achieve the effects of improving efficiency, expanding service scope, and improving recall rate

Inactive Publication Date: 2010-10-13
TIANJIN UNIV
View PDF0 Cites 9 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Therefore, these service discovery tools have their own applicat

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for establishment of service discovery tool based on service network
  • Method for establishment of service discovery tool based on service network
  • Method for establishment of service discovery tool based on service network

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0032] The present invention will be described in detail below. The service discovery tool established by the present invention can be divided into three parts:

[0033] (1) Establish an abstract index layer, match requirements through the abstract index layer, discover services in a constant order of time, and improve efficiency.

[0034] Assuming that for each service request model, it is necessary to traverse the entire service network and match all services. This method is undoubtedly too large and inefficient. The present invention solves this problem. By establishing an abstract index layer, for each service request, the time complexity is changed from O(n) to O(1), thereby greatly improving the efficiency of service discovery.

[0035] The corresponding relationship between the index layer and the specific service layer is as follows figure 2 Shown.

[0036] The establishment process of the label index layer, see image 3 . First, extract all service tags from specific servic...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ention belongs to the technical field of the computer service network, and relates to a method for establishment of a service discovery tool based on a service network, which comprises the following steps: extracting service tags from specific services, and removing repeated tags; for the service tags, finding a specific service comprising a corresponding service tag; establishing a corresponding relationship between each tag and a specific service; creating a tag index layer; positioning center services; for the center services, establishing expansion services between the center services and relevant services, wherein an expansion service list comprises a center service ID, a relationship type and services related to the center service; extracting service information from the service network, and working out a service discovery program based on the service network; and carrying out application program interface packaging for the service discovery program. The service discovery tool established in the invention can fully utilize the structure of the service network, and feedback the service to the user comprehensively, accurately and quickly, thereby satisfying the needs of the user.

Description

Technical field [0001] The invention relates to a semantic-based service network, in particular to a semantic-based service network service discovery tool. Background technique [0002] Web service discovery is the process of locating or discovering one or more documents describing a particular Web service. Service discovery tools can find many different types and forms of Web services provided by Web service providers, and execute Web service requests. [0003] The service discovery tool of the present invention is designed and implemented on the basis of the service network. The service network and current service discovery at home and abroad are introduced as follows. [0004] 1. Service network [0005] A service network is a network composed of services and relationships between services. It takes services as nodes and the relationships between services as edges. Among them, services can be divided into abstract services and specific services. The relationship between servic...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F17/30H04L29/06
Inventor 冯志勇刘雅琼陈世展王辉徐金娜
Owner TIANJIN UNIV
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products